网站如何解决图片过大加载慢的问题?

看看这些人的想法能不能帮上你:
甲:
1,不太“在乎”用户体验的省事方法:图片保存成渐进式的,加载会慢慢变清晰,而不是从上往下依次加载,然后放在 CDN,设置缓存之类。
2,比较“在乎”用户体验的高端方案:判断用户的设备(主要用在移动端)、网络等,分别加载不同质量的图片(例如高端 iPhone wifi 情况下,就可以加载双倍高清图等,蜂窝网络下面,就加载个单倍或者有损压缩过的)。或者先加载低质量的图片,让浏览者可以看到,然后再在后台加载更高清的,等加载完了,浏览者还在观看,就插入替换掉。或者先加载低质量小图片列表,然后让用户点击,触发类似 fancybox 的效果,弹窗出现大图片。或者利用资源预加载(三个 HTML5 不常见特性简介)当用户还没打开的时候,就开始加载。还有好多思路,后面想到再补充。

乙:
压缩,预加载,缓存,图床。(本人比较推荐)

丙:
1.使用缓存
2.使用CDN加速
3.使用jq延迟加载图片, 用到那个 加载哪个.
4.加大服务器宽带
5.检查服务器硬盘读取速度

丁:
要尽可能的压缩,看用户的忍受程度。jpg 可以用很多方法压缩,png 推荐使用 工具(不过正文图片,显然要选择 jpg 格式的)。推荐个压缩图片的神器:https://tinypng.com/ ,不过缺点就是不能设置压缩比例。只能直接压缩至最小。作为大banner图的有时候清晰度就不够达标。

你可能感兴趣的:(图片修改)